Protein Information
Name FLOT2
Synonyms ESA1, M17S1
Function May act as a scaffolding protein within caveolar membranes, functionally participating in formation of caveolae or caveolae-like vesicles. May be involved in epidermal cell adhesion and epidermal structure and function.
Cellular Location Cell membrane; Peripheral membrane protein. Membrane, caveola; Peripheral membrane protein. Endosome Membrane; Lipid-anchor. Note=Membrane- associated protein of caveolae
Tissue Location In skin, expressed in epidermis and epidermal appendages but not in dermis. Expressed in all layers of the epidermis except the basal layer. In hair follicles, expressed in the suprabasal layer but not the basal layer. Also expressed in melanoma and carcinoma cell lines, fibroblasts and foreskin melanocytes

Background

Caveolae are small domains on the inner cell membrane involved in vesicular trafficking and signal transduction. This gene encodes a caveolae-associated, integral membrane protein, which is thought to function in neuronal signaling.
